Laurel Springs School specializes in customized curriculum, which means every student can learn at their own pace, in a way that works best for them. The school is a WASC, NISAC and NCAA approved distance learning program, which utilizes live teachers and a learning styles inventory to complement and support its curriculum. The Learning Style Profile measures your child's talents, interests, and learning environment, as well as the way he or she intakes and processes information. The faculty and staff of the school then use that profile to create the curriculum for each individual student. This system is especially good for special needs students, gifted/talented students, homeschoolers, and teen athletes and stars (hence the nickname "School to the Stars.") Homeschoolers benefit from the ready-to-use format of the school's program and curriculum, which includes all the basics such as books, study guides, accreditation, transcripts and diplomas. Students at the school also have access to pre-assessment, enrollment and college counseling, and various levels of teacher service and interaction. Like its curriculum, this system allows each family to receive as much support as they need. They have a family newsletter, a high school newsletter and a "teen voice" newsletter, to stay connected. They also have a "family center," premiering soon on their website. The flexibility of the program works well for homeschoolers who often use an adaptable schedule to accommodate activities and commitments that supplement their learning such as sports, field trips, and community service. Teachers and/or tutors are readily available via email, telephone, or on location, and the Web-based classes allow students to work from their home or on the road. Parents facilitate the instruction of the material and are assisted by a Laurel Springs teacher. Students can develop their own elective portfolio, which allows for student-designed electives such as research, tutorials, workshops, seminars, apprenticeships, travel, conferences, private classes, religious studies, community service, and local community college courses. The all-inclusive nature of the program and the fact that many homeschoolers are self-directed means that parents' schedules can be more flexible as well, especially with older students. This allows homeschoolers to continue on with homeschooling past the elementary school years, when many homeschooling parents begin to question their ability to proceed. In addition to the flexibility of the curriculum, the program itself allows students to enroll at any time of the year and begin online classes immediately, although all courses are divided into thirty-six lessons over a one-year period. Students can sign on for an entire program or take just one semester, or one class. The elementary school curriculum combines textbooks and projects for courses that allow children time for exploration, emotional growth, and physical development. The junior high curriculum also includes Choices (learning style-based activities), and Online courses, and the high school program provides a complete 9-12 program and academic diploma. More about the founder: Marilyn Mosley established Laurel Springs School in 1991 based on her many years experience in the field of alternative education.
